Struct vulkanalia_sys::ExternalFenceHandleTypeFlags[][src]

#[repr(transparent)]pub struct ExternalFenceHandleTypeFlags { /* fields omitted */ }

Implementations

impl ExternalFenceHandleTypeFlags[src]

pub const OPAQUE_FD: ExternalFenceHandleTypeFlags[src]

pub const OPAQUE_WIN32: ExternalFenceHandleTypeFlags[src]

pub const OPAQUE_WIN32_KMT: ExternalFenceHandleTypeFlags[src]

pub const SYNC_FD: ExternalFenceHandleTypeFlags[src]

pub const fn empty() -> ExternalFenceHandleTypeFlags[src]

Returns an empty set of flags

pub const fn all() -> ExternalFenceHandleTypeFlags[src]

Returns the set containing all flags.

pub const fn bits(&self) -> Flags[src]

Returns the raw value of the flags currently stored.

pub fn from_bits(bits: Flags) -> Option<ExternalFenceHandleTypeFlags>[src]

Convert from underlying bit representation, unless that representation contains bits that do not correspond to a flag.

pub const fn from_bits_truncate(bits: Flags) -> ExternalFenceHandleTypeFlags[src]

Convert from underlying bit representation, dropping any bits that do not correspond to flags.

pub const unsafe fn from_bits_unchecked(
    bits: Flags
) -> ExternalFenceHandleTypeFlags
[src]

Convert from underlying bit representation, preserving all bits (even those not corresponding to a defined flag).

pub const fn is_empty(&self) -> bool[src]

Returns true if no flags are currently stored.

pub const fn is_all(&self) -> bool[src]

Returns true if all flags are currently set.

pub const fn intersects(&self, other: ExternalFenceHandleTypeFlags) -> bool[src]

Returns true if there are flags common to both self and other.

pub const fn contains(&self, other: ExternalFenceHandleTypeFlags) -> bool[src]

Returns true all of the flags in other are contained within self.

pub fn insert(&mut self, other: ExternalFenceHandleTypeFlags)[src]

Inserts the specified flags in-place.

pub fn remove(&mut self, other: ExternalFenceHandleTypeFlags)[src]

Removes the specified flags in-place.

pub fn toggle(&mut self, other: ExternalFenceHandleTypeFlags)[src]

Toggles the specified flags in-place.

pub fn set(&mut self, other: ExternalFenceHandleTypeFlags, value: bool)[src]

Inserts or removes the specified flags depending on the passed value.
